“Cheery was aware that Commander Vimes didn’t like the phrase “The innocent have nothing to fear,” believing the innocent had everything to fear, mostly from the guilty but in the longer term even more from those who say things like “The innocent have nothing to fear”.
Excerpt From
Snuff
Pratchett, Terry, Sir

We're not "over-diagnosing", we're getting BETTER at diagnosing. That was the point of all those years of research.
And yes, more people are self-diagnosing, but that's because they are better informed. That was the whole point of raising awareness!
The more we are aware of these issues, the better we understand them, ourselves and each other, and the easier it is for us to manage and treat them. But we cannot do that if the funding and support isn't there! #MentalHealth
